Transponder
Honda is one of the few car brands to provide transponder keys with every new car. These keys can only be used to access the car of the owner and protect it from theft. The keys store an individual password that is transmitted via radio signals when activated by the specific antenna that is located in your ignition system. The anti-theft will only start the car if the "password", which is stored in the system, matches. This protects your investment and keeps your vehicle safe.
